diff options
| author | Dave DeLong | 2011-03-25 11:11:13 -0700 | 
|---|---|---|
| committer | Dave DeLong | 2011-03-25 11:11:13 -0700 | 
| commit | 8c2ee2148e6f35674b0b0c7701f0ae306ec230d5 (patch) | |
| tree | 72db848c68a70c77dbc1a974aad247efe3e17e09 | |
| parent | d02e7a9a02bf580ab82a404a6ff5fdc5ce2f1ebb (diff) | |
| download | DDHotKey-8c2ee2148e6f35674b0b0c7701f0ae306ec230d5.tar.bz2 | |
Fixed a 32/64 bit conversion warning
| -rw-r--r-- | DDHotKeyCenter.m | 8 | 
1 files changed, 4 insertions, 4 deletions
| diff --git a/DDHotKeyCenter.m b/DDHotKeyCenter.m index 68b4c5c..465baac 100644 --- a/DDHotKeyCenter.m +++ b/DDHotKeyCenter.m @@ -17,7 +17,7 @@  static NSMutableSet * _registeredHotKeys = nil;  static UInt32 _nextHotKeyID = 1;  OSStatus dd_hotKeyHandler(EventHandlerCallRef nextHandler, EventRef theEvent, void * userData); -NSUInteger dd_translateModifierFlags(NSUInteger flags); +UInt32 dd_translateModifierFlags(NSUInteger flags);  NSString* dd_stringifyModifierFlags(NSUInteger flags);  #pragma mark DDHotKey @@ -122,7 +122,7 @@ NSString* dd_stringifyModifierFlags(NSUInteger flags);  	keyID.id = _nextHotKeyID;  	EventHotKeyRef carbonHotKey; -	NSUInteger flags = dd_translateModifierFlags(modifierFlags); +	UInt32 flags = dd_translateModifierFlags(modifierFlags);  	OSStatus err = RegisterEventHotKey(keyCode, flags, keyID, GetEventDispatcherTarget(), 0, &carbonHotKey);  	//error registering hot key @@ -291,8 +291,8 @@ OSStatus dd_hotKeyHandler(EventHandlerCallRef nextHandler, EventRef theEvent, vo  	return noErr;  } -NSUInteger dd_translateModifierFlags(NSUInteger flags) { -	NSUInteger newFlags = 0; +UInt32 dd_translateModifierFlags(NSUInteger flags) { +	UInt32 newFlags = 0;  	if ((flags & NSControlKeyMask) > 0) { newFlags |= controlKey; }  	if ((flags & NSCommandKeyMask) > 0) { newFlags |= cmdKey; }  	if ((flags & NSShiftKeyMask) > 0) { newFlags |= shiftKey; } | 
